Dairy Association-
[Bt Telegraph.] (Oar Own Correspondent.) Wellington, Thursday. The newly formed North Island Dairy Association has decided to shortly appoint a permanent Secretary in Wellington. In the meantime Mr George Fairbrother, of Carterton, acts as Secretary. The ' representative Committee were elected this morning. They are-Messrs G H. Scales (Gisborne), Pierard (Hawera), Oldham- (Patea), Nathan (Palmerston N.), and Geo. Fairbrother (Carterton). MrSayers, the Government expert, is also on thfc directorate as an ex-officio member. Later. The delegates of the Pairy Companies met again this morning and "Seir conference is still continuing. A proposal to form a North Island New Zealand Dairy Association was confirmed, and rules similar to those used by the South Island Association were adopted. Tha objects of the new body are to disseminate information which will lead to an improvement in the manufacture of dairy produce; to secsre the best and cheapest means of transit; and to provide facilities for obtaining favourable markets and good financial returns. Those present ' at the meeting displayed conrtderable energetic pood fueling and their demeanour indicates that matters will not ba allowed to sleep after the conference is over. Progress is evidently intended. Mr. Sayers, Government Expert, was present, and kindly gave much useful information.
